Abstract
This paper discusses a new quantitative evaluation of the artificial kidney. Newly defined dialysance, which is a characterization parameter of module performance, is derived from a consideration of dialysis as well as filtration effects.
This newly defined dialysance is independent of both incoming blood concentration and time, if all of the operating parameters are kept constant with respect to time. It was further proved to be more useful, especially in the case of high ultrafiltration therapies such as hemodiafiltration or hemofiltration.
